Important differences between Nutmeg and Parsley

  • Nutmeg has more Manganese, Copper, Fiber, Magnesium, and Phosphorus, however, Parsley has more Vitamin K, Vitamin C, Vitamin A RAE, and Iron.
  • Parsley's daily need coverage for Vitamin K is 1367% more.
  • Nutmeg has 197 times more Saturated Fat than Parsley. Nutmeg has 25.94g of Saturated Fat, while Parsley has 0.132g.

The food varieties used in the comparison are Spices, nutmeg, ground and Parsley, fresh.

All nutrients comparison - raw data values

Nutrient Nutmeg Parsley Opinion
Net carbs 28.49g 3.03g Nutmeg
Protein 5.84g 2.97g Nutmeg
Fats 36.31g 0.79g Nutmeg
Carbs 49.29g 6.33g Nutmeg
Calories 525kcal 36kcal Nutmeg
Sugar 2.99g 0.85g Parsley
Fiber 20.8g 3.3g Nutmeg
Calcium 184mg 138mg Nutmeg
Iron 3.04mg 6.2mg Parsley
Magnesium 183mg 50mg Nutmeg
Phosphorus 213mg 58mg Nutmeg
Potassium 350mg 554mg Parsley
Sodium 16mg 56mg Nutmeg
Zinc 2.15mg 1.07mg Nutmeg
Copper 1.027mg 0.149mg Nutmeg
Manganese 2.9mg 0.16mg Nutmeg
Selenium 1.6µg 0.1µg Nutmeg
Vitamin A 102IU 8424IU Parsley
Vitamin A RAE 5µg 421µg Parsley
Vitamin E 0mg 0.75mg Parsley
Vitamin C 3mg 133mg Parsley
Vitamin B1 0.346mg 0.086mg Nutmeg
Vitamin B2 0.057mg 0.098mg Parsley
Vitamin B3 1.299mg 1.313mg Parsley
Vitamin B5 0.4mg Parsley
Vitamin B6 0.16mg 0.09mg Nutmeg
Folate 76µg 152µg Parsley
Vitamin K 0µg 1640µg Parsley
